Lewis Library

Established in 1866, Lewis Library is the second oldest library in the State of Missouri and the oldest library building in continuous use west of the Mississippi.

Glasgow Museum

The building housing the Glasgow Museum is listed on the National Register of Historic Places and was given to the city in 1976. The Gothic Revival building, originally a Baptist church, was constructed in 1861

Stump Island Park

Stump Island Park is located on the site of the June 10-11, 1804, camp named "Stump Island" in Lewis and Clark's journal. An interpretive sign is posted there.
